Chemically, Cyclohexanone (C6H10O) is a six-carbon cyclic ketone with a characteristic molecular structure that imparts its solvent properties. It typically appears as a clear, colorless liquid with moderate volatility and a ketone-like aroma. Production involves oxidation of cyclohexane or hydrogenation of phenol in controlled industrial processes, optimized to yield high-purity and low-impurity material suitable for downstream syntheses.
Its solvent power arises from the polar carbonyl group coupled with a non-polar cyclohexane ring, enabling dissolution of a variety of organic polymers, resins, and adhesives. This solvent action facilitates ink and paint formulation by improving flow properties and adhesion. Cyclohexanone also acts as a key chemical intermediate in the production of caprolactam for Nylon 6, where it undergoes conversion through oximation and Beckmann rearrangement routes.
Performance-wise, Cyclohexanone offers a boiling point near 155°C, which makes it less volatile than acetone but more effective as a slow-evaporating solvent in coatings application. Its solvency allows compatibility with nitrocellulose, cellulose acetate, and various synthetic resins, aiding film formation and finish quality. For industrial users, properties such as flash point, purity levels, and residual water content influence handling safety and processing conditions. Because of flammability and possible health hazards on inhalation or skin contact, strict storage and handling protocols are mandatory.
